In a remarkable display of dedication and teamwork, the Prairie View A&M University (PVAMU) College of Engineering Recruitment and Retention Committee, Dr. Dada, Dr. Olanrewaju, Dr. McIntyre and Dr. Shamim, celebrated a resounding success at their recent recruiting event held at KIPP Sunnyside High School.

The event, which aimed to engage with students and showcase opportunities at PVAMU, exceeded all expectations, thanks to the unwavering commitment of the committee members. Their hard work and dedication paid off as they delivered acceptance envelopes to an impressive total of 45 KIPP Seniors who have been accepted to PVAMU. This significant achievement marked a threefold increase from the previous year, highlighting the effectiveness of their recruitment efforts.

Beyond the acceptance letters, the PVAMU team also had the privilege of presenting to 20 rising juniors about the university’s esteemed engineering program.
